Population and Sample concepts form a fundamental component of Grade 7 mathematics curriculum, providing students with essential statistical literacy skills through comprehensive presentations available on Wayground. These educational resources focus on helping seventh-grade students distinguish between populations and samples, understand sampling methods, and recognize how sample data can be used to make inferences about larger populations. The presentations emphasize concept explanation through visual learning and structured instruction, enabling students to grasp the relationship between data collection techniques and statistical validity. Students develop critical analytical skills as they explore real-world scenarios where sampling is necessary, learn to identify potential bias in sampling methods, and understand how sample size affects the reliability of statistical conclusions.
